Hello i have a 1998 eagle talon tsi FWD with a 6bolt swap and stock 14b turbo. some stuff on her is rigged a little but shes a work in progress and i bought her that way, only owned her for about 3 days now. When i bought the car i was told it was running at 15psi ( maxed the stock boost gauge out No problem) however when i hooked up a autometer gauge it was only reading at about 9psi max. When i drove her home she boosted fine and was very audible. Day 2 i got on her a little and on about the 4th pull i grabbed 1st then 2nd and on 3rd she fell on her nose and sputtered and wouldnt rev past 4k with boost. If i eased her and didnt build boost it was fine ( also only did this under a load and in neutral she was fine). Got home and was freaking out
. Checked all the normal stuff, Shaft play, wastegate actuator was working, when i checked vacuum lines i found a line running from the Intake manifold to the back of the intake to a small sensor with a little nipple on it, looks like it should be bolted somewhere or onto something ( not with a hose just dangling on it) however since they were in the same area together and that hose wasnt hooked up i put it on the sensor. To my suprise i was able to boost to max and seemed to run fine until i gave her WOT, Then she sputtered and wouldnt go past whatever RPM it was at when it started sputtering. I am now not building boost as much or as fast. only around 6psi. What happened? Also might add that now i hear what sounds like air fluttering back out of the breather, The BOV is doing its job to some extent because thats still pretty audible. I am thinking maybe Boost leak? The only other thing i feel i should add is that i hooked up my A/F and says im running lean, never anything else just lean. I hooked it up correctly i think
. I ran the wires to pin 76 on the ecu which is what the tutorial said. Im going to post some pictures and please if you see anything wrong say what you want about it
not my any of my handy work. i just want my car to run right.
